As a former resident I would not recommend this apartment there were several things wrong when I first moved in 2 of them were major
1. The first real cold spell in 2004 there was no heat for about a week & a half due to the furnace being replaced
2. The same time there was no heat there was also no hot water due to the water heater being replaced.
These were the 2 most serious problems especially having a pet & it was around 40 degrees at night.
Another problem was the noise level, there was no sound proofing & you hear everything your neighbors say & do
3. did not feel safe on premise
& to make a long list short
4. Was not happy with maintenance when problems were fixed in the unit it was half done & had to be repaired several times or only part of the problem would be fixed & they would not come back out to fix the whole problem.
This is a live at your own risk apartment complex
